The Korean Secret to Radiant Beauty
Glass skin, the coveted dream skin texture, has taken the world by thunder. This translucent, luminous complexion is achieved through a dedicated routine of skincare that focuses on intense hydration and gentle exfoliation. It's all about creating a smooth, poreless canvas that allows light to reflect, resulting in the coveted "glassy" appearance.
The key to achieving glass skin lies in using high-quality ingredients packed with antioxidants and hydrating agents. Serial layering is also crucial, allowing each product to penetrate deeply into the skin.
Some essential steps in this transformative journey include double cleansing, exfoliation with enzyme peels, a hydrating ampoule, and a rich moisturizer. Don't forget to finish with a UV protectant – the ultimate protector of that glass skin!

Explore The Ultimate Guide to K-Beauty for Beginners
Welcome to k-beauty the fascinating world of K-Beauty! K-beauty is renowned for its innovative formulas and focus on glowing, radiant skin. This guide will introduce the essentials to get you started on your K-Beauty journey.
First, let's explore the basic routine of a typical K-beauty regimen. A common system involves double cleansing, exfoliating, using serums, and moisturizing.
* Double cleansing involves two cleansers: an oil-based one to dissolve makeup and sunscreen, followed by a water-based cleanser for deeper cleaning.
* Exfoliating helps remove dead skin cells, showing brighter, more youthful skin.
Sheet masks, a K-beauty staple, are packed with ingredients to hydrate your skin. Choose from a extensive range of types according to your specific skin concerns.
